The Forkpath assignment service returns a deterministic variant for each (experiment, subject) pair via GET /assign. Assignments are sticky for the experiment's lifetime; flipping traffic splits never reassigns existing subjects. Release managers should freeze experiment configs before a rollout and verify the active split with GET /experiments/{id}. Responses are cached for 60 seconds. All calls require the service bearer token given below.

portal login ticket: eyJhbGciOiJIUzI1NiIsInR5cCI6IkpXVCJ9.eyJzdWIiOiIwEOsktwVNwIn0.-UJU3fdyyCgG

Step 4: Re-point the Vellenkamp partner SFTP drop. The old Harwick ingest host is decommissioned after this release, so the poller in `drift-relay` must read from the new endpoint before cutover. Verify the retry window matches what partners agreed to, and confirm the archive directory is writable by the service account. The poller expects the following configuration values.

config for kafof-bawef:
holath:
  log_level: debug
  metrics_host: metrics.holath.qorvelsys.internal
  pin: 2191
  pool_size: 32

MEMO — Department Heads

Quick heads-up: warranty costs on the Torvix R2 line came in 38% over plan last quarter, mostly hinge failures out of the Melden plant. Ops is rerunning supplier audits and Quality is tightening inbound checks, but the overrun will hit this quarter's margin too. Keep this out of team meetings for now. The bigger picture is covered in the confidential note below.

confidential, yahip-hagug: Gorixax Logistics plans to lower the Ulaael list price by 26.6 percent in October. The pricing group signed off on a budget of $199.9 million for Project Holix. The renewal with Kasdorox Systems closes at $137.5 million a year, 8.2 percent above the last contract. Project Lamion slips by a full year because of the audit delay.

# Break-glass access — Catalogue Import Service

For the weekly eng sync: the Shelfwright library catalogue import pipeline has a break-glass account for emergencies only, such as a corrupted MARC batch blocking overnight ingestion for the Dunmore branch network. Use of the account triggers an automatic audit entry and a page to the on-call lead, so treat it as a last resort after normal escalation fails. Document every action taken in the incident log. To activate break-glass access, enter the recovery passphrase shown below.

unlock words, yawig-kagef: gordor-holvan-ulaael-pramir-ulaiel-tamdor